First, originally "Old Row" referred to fraternities on the west side of campus that did not move to the east side when new fraternity row opened in the early 1960s. It did NOT refer to sororities. It is the fraternities whose houses have always been on University Blvd and stayed there when most of the houses moved to Jefferson back in the 1950's and 1960's i.e. new row. As another poster indicated sororities where known as circles i.e.In 1986, when the black sorority Alpha Kappa Alpha was planning to move to the previously all-white sorority row, two white students burned a cross on the front lawn of the new house.The new documentary addresses some, but not all, of the Bama Rush phenomenon, aiming to shed light on the massive mental, emotional, and physical toll that comes with rush week.
